Playa Grande Resort

Best Things Nearby:
Easy walking distance to town. Great crafts market just down the hill. Close to marina.

Best Things About the Resort:
New resort with very comfortable, nice rooms; five pools, one of which is adults only; staff very friendly.

Resort Experience:
Very beautiful resort with pools and waterways in the center. Has the feel of an old European town. Rooms are plush, with beautiful wood, marble, and stone. Balconies with every room. Every room has ocean view; you can hear waves crashing at night. Every morning, there were lawnmowers - so unpleasant to have morning coffee on the balcony, just too noisy .I could have mowed all the grass they had in one morning. Pool area gets very loud in the afternoon when drunk volleyball starts with happy hour (two-for-one drinks). Great spa and gym, easy to make appointment or drop in. Two restaurants with good food, but not a very big menu. Most of the evenings, we had to call to have the futon made up - the maids didn't remember. One night they had to send security man because all the other staff had left.

Captain Tony's

Restaurant

Captain Tony's

Great fish tacos and fruit smoothies. Right on the marina in an open patio setting. Cool breezes while watching marina and people-watching. The portions are very generous (hard to finish it all). So much shrimp or fish in the tacos, you had to remove some to eat it. Other types of Mexican cuisine available.

ATV adventure

We went through Baja's to arrange our ATVing. Got the tour for both of us as a gift for attending timeshare presentation. The location is north of Cabo. Baja's picks you up and returns you to your resort. The area for ATVs is north of town in a state park. Beautiful desert right next to fabulous private beach. Both group ATVing and time to go off on your own to explore. They provide cold water and guide. Very fun, and they also have a paramedic accompany the group for safety. Highly recommend them.

Mexican Fiesta

Every Saturday at Solmar, they throw a Mexican Fiesta. For $35 USD, you can eat as much as you want and order any drink you want, all included. The food is very good: serviche, roast pig, tamales, quesadillas, soups, etc. With the dinner is a show by a local dance troupe performing dances from different parts of Mexico, with costumes reflecting the different regions. They are very good. Emcee breaks up the dancing with activities for diners to show off and be embarrassed...very entertaining.
